I had my own little scare today. I have been having sharp pains in my pelvic area/ lower right side by my groin. It has been coming and going, but today- it knocked me off my feet. It hurt so bad, I was scared to death. It felt like someone was punching me there.

So I called the nurse. She was concerned with this and my dizzy spells earlier this week- so she got my doc on right away.

The doc has told me that it sounds like Round Ligament pains. She told me to drink lots of water (Already am doing that...), and rest off my feet the rest of today. Tonight and Tomorrow am I should take my temp and see if I have a fever and to check if I have any spotting... If I do- I'm to go to the ER. If not, she wants to have me check in with her again.

So- I've been reading online about Round Ligament Pain, and all I'm finding is saying it is 2nd Trimester pain--not 4-5 week pain. So I called the nurse again the next day. I heard back from the "head nurse" at 4:15pm.


The nurse asked questions about where my pain was. I told her my concern about only reading that Round Ligament Pains being in 2nd trimester. After reading my charts from my discussion yesterday, she tells me that it's likely an ectopic pregnancy. Just like that. No sensitivity, nothing.

She said that if my pain is disctinctly on one side- which it is- that is the most common symptom. I asked her how we confirm. She said I can try to go to the ER, but it's too soon in my pregnancy (I'm 5 weeks) to really have an ultrasound prove anything. She said by end of next week I might be able to go in and they could tell.

I didnt want to believe it- so I reaffirmed that I have no spotting or a fever. She said- well, that can come later.

I understand they can't "tell you anything for fear of malpractice" but she bascially put nothing but fear and worry into my head. I'm too early to get a conclusive ultrasound result and can't really "do" anything. At that point, I'm angry she even told me this- cuz If I can't do anything, I don't want to know. It just makes me sick with worry.

She did say if I get a continuous stabbing pain that does not go away, to go to the ER. Either way, I plan to discuss with my doc if she ever calls me back today.
